49ers vs. Ravens Week 1 Preseason Odds & NFL Betting Free Pick

NFL Preseason Week 1 – San Francisco vs Baltimore

The Baltimore Ravens start their preseason at home against the San Francisco 49ers on Thursday. This is a game that’ll provide more intensity than other games this week, as the Harbaugh brothers go H2H.

When: Thursday, Aug 7th 2014 at 7:30pm ET
Where: M&T Bank
TV: NFL Network
Line: PK – O/U 35

John Harbaugh and the Ravens missed out on the playoffs last year and will want to jump out quickly this year. Jim Harbaugh and the 49ers lost in the NFC Championship last year and will be looking to improve.

Both of the Harbaugh brothers have winning preseason records with their current team. The Ravens have only gone 2-2 while the 49ers have gone 3-1 in each of the last two years during preseason though.

The 49ers are going to be one of the best teams in the NFL again this year and they typically like to get out to a good start even in the preseason. I read earlier that Colin Kaepernick will play 1-2 drives.

I don’t expect Joe Flacco to play much more than that either. For Baltimore we can expect to see Taylor and Wenning split most of the snaps. Blaine Gabbert will likely get most of the snaps for the 49ers.

Gabbert isn’t a good QB, but I prefer him to the Ravens back-up QB’s. The RB edge goes to SF also, as they have some great young talent. We should see a lot of Carlos Hyde who is the back up to Gore.

Baltimore will likely have more problems at RB this season. Rice is injured and dealing with off field issues while Pierce is coming off surgery. The o-line for the Ravens should be better, but still not a strong point.

I’m interested to see how newly signed WR’s Stevie Johnson and Brandon Lloyd look for SF. The Niners will also use rookie Bruce Ellington. Baltimore signed veteran Steve Smith to bolster their WR unit.

San Fran has way more depth on offense and they’re better at QB, RB, WR and o-line. The Ravens DEF is much the same this year. It’ll be interesting to see if their d-line can improve, as there is a lot talent.

The secondary for Baltimore also has some questions to answer. The 49ers will be a big question mark on their defense as well this season after losing three players to free agency during the off-season.

San Francisco has the better d-line with much more depth, which will play a role throughout the entire preseason. In a game like this where starters won’t play much you have to look at the depth of a team.

The Niners have more depth on both sides of the football. Traveling on the road is tough, but the 49ers are a team that hate to lose regardless of the situation and I expect them to cover the spread.

San Fran has young RB’s that will want to make a good impression during the preseason. I expect Hyde to shine this month for SF. If the Niners run the football their defense will handle the rest.

Recent NFL Betting Trends:

  • Under is 6-1 in 49ers last 7 Thursday games.
  • 49ers are 8-2 ATS in their last 10 road games.
  • Under is 8-3 in 49ers last 11 games overall.
  • Ravens are 1-5 ATS in their last 6 Thursday games.
  • Over is 4-1 in Ravens last 5 games on fieldturf.
  • Ravens are 1-4 ATS in their last 5 games on fieldturf.

49ers vs. Ravens Free Pick

San Francisco 49ers PK (-110)
